Tex. Occ. Code § 2153.302

MANDATORY DENIAL OF GENERAL BUSINESS LICENSE

Acts 1999, 76th Leg., ch. 388, Sec. 1, eff

The comptroller may not issue a general business license if the comptroller finds that the applicant has been:

(1) finally convicted of a felony during the five years preceding the date of application; or

(2) placed on community supervision or released on parole for a felony conviction during the two years preceding the date of application.
